Coventry University, located in the vibrant city of Coventry, UK, offers a distinguished BSc (Hons) Mathematics program spanning four years, including a valuable placement opportunity. This undergraduate degree is meticulously crafted to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of mathematical theory and its practical applications, preparing them for diverse career paths in various industries.
Curriculum: The curriculum of the BSc (Hons) Mathematics program at Coventry University is meticulously designed to cover a wide range of mathematical topics, including calculus, algebra, geometry, differential equations, and mathematical modeling. Students delve into advanced areas such as optimization, complex analysis, and numerical methods, gaining both theoretical knowledge and practical skills. The program emphasizes hands-on learning through projects, laboratory sessions, and computational exercises, ensuring graduates are well-equipped to tackle real-world challenges.

Coventry University offers a range of scholarships and bursaries to undergraduate international students, based on academic merit and financial need.
Future Global Leaders Scholarship: This scholarship is available for undergraduate and postgraduate students and covers up to 50% of the tuition fees. It is awarded based on academic excellence, extracurricular activities, and leadership skills.
Sports Scholarships: Coventry University offers sports scholarships to students who excel in their chosen sport. The scholarship covers financial support, coaching, and access to university sports facilities.
GREAT Scholarships: Coventry University is a partner of the GREAT Scholarship Scheme, which offers scholarships to students from selected countries. The scholarship covers up to £10,000 of tuition fees.
Coventry University Alumni Discount: Coventry University offers a 15% discount on the tuition fees for international students who have previously studied at the university.
It is important to note that eligibility criteria, application deadlines, and award amounts vary for each scholarship.
